Arcane  4.1.12.0
Developer documentation
Loading...
Searching...
No Matches
Arcane::CartesianMeshAllocateBuildInfoInternal Class Reference

Internal part of CartesianMeshAllocateBuildInfo. More...

#include <arcane/core/internal/CartesianMeshAllocateBuildInfoInternal.h>

Collaboration diagram for Arcane::CartesianMeshAllocateBuildInfoInternal:

Public Member Functions

Int32 meshDimension () const
void setFaceBuilderVersion (Int32 version)
 Positionne la version utilisée pour le calcul des uniqueId() des faces.
Int32 faceBuilderVersion () const
 Version utilisée pour le calcul des des uniqueId() des faces.
void setEdgeBuilderVersion (Int32 version)
 Positionne la version utilisée pour le calcul des uniqueId() des arêtes.
Int32 edgeBuilderVersion () const
 Version utilisée pour le calcul des uniqueId() des arêtes.
const Int64x3 & globalNbCells () const
const Int32x3 & ownNbCells () const
const Int64x3 & firstOwnCellOffset () const
Int64 cellUniqueIdOffset () const
Int64 nodeUniqueIdOffset () const

Private Attributes

CartesianMeshAllocateBuildInfo::Implm_p = nullptr

Friends

class CartesianMeshAllocateBuildInfo::Impl

Detailed Description

Member Function Documentation

◆ cellUniqueIdOffset()

Int64 Arcane::CartesianMeshAllocateBuildInfoInternal::cellUniqueIdOffset ( ) const

Definition at line 141 of file CartesianMeshAllocateBuildInfo.cc.

◆ edgeBuilderVersion()

Int32 Arcane::CartesianMeshAllocateBuildInfoInternal::edgeBuilderVersion ( ) const

Version utilisée pour le calcul des uniqueId() des arêtes.

Definition at line 105 of file CartesianMeshAllocateBuildInfo.cc.

◆ faceBuilderVersion()

Int32 Arcane::CartesianMeshAllocateBuildInfoInternal::faceBuilderVersion ( ) const

Version utilisée pour le calcul des des uniqueId() des faces.

Definition at line 87 of file CartesianMeshAllocateBuildInfo.cc.

◆ firstOwnCellOffset()

const Int64x3 & Arcane::CartesianMeshAllocateBuildInfoInternal::firstOwnCellOffset ( ) const

Definition at line 132 of file CartesianMeshAllocateBuildInfo.cc.

◆ globalNbCells()

const Int64x3 & Arcane::CartesianMeshAllocateBuildInfoInternal::globalNbCells ( ) const

Definition at line 114 of file CartesianMeshAllocateBuildInfo.cc.

◆ meshDimension()

Int32 Arcane::CartesianMeshAllocateBuildInfoInternal::meshDimension ( ) const

Definition at line 69 of file CartesianMeshAllocateBuildInfo.cc.

◆ nodeUniqueIdOffset()

Int64 Arcane::CartesianMeshAllocateBuildInfoInternal::nodeUniqueIdOffset ( ) const

Definition at line 150 of file CartesianMeshAllocateBuildInfo.cc.

◆ ownNbCells()

const Int32x3 & Arcane::CartesianMeshAllocateBuildInfoInternal::ownNbCells ( ) const

Definition at line 123 of file CartesianMeshAllocateBuildInfo.cc.

◆ setEdgeBuilderVersion()

void Arcane::CartesianMeshAllocateBuildInfoInternal::setEdgeBuilderVersion ( Int32 version)

Positionne la version utilisée pour le calcul des uniqueId() des arêtes.

Definition at line 96 of file CartesianMeshAllocateBuildInfo.cc.

◆ setFaceBuilderVersion()

void Arcane::CartesianMeshAllocateBuildInfoInternal::setFaceBuilderVersion ( Int32 version)

Positionne la version utilisée pour le calcul des uniqueId() des faces.

Definition at line 78 of file CartesianMeshAllocateBuildInfo.cc.

◆ CartesianMeshAllocateBuildInfo::Impl

Definition at line 33 of file CartesianMeshAllocateBuildInfoInternal.h.

Member Data Documentation

◆ m_p

CartesianMeshAllocateBuildInfo::Impl* Arcane::CartesianMeshAllocateBuildInfoInternal::m_p = nullptr
private

Definition at line 61 of file CartesianMeshAllocateBuildInfoInternal.h.


The documentation for this class was generated from the following files: